As educators, we are all aware of the significant impact that prior knowledge has on students’ learning experiences. Activating prior knowledge is the process of connecting new information to what students already knows. It is creating a strong foundation for students’ learning process. It also helps teachers to create meaningful, memorable activities for students. By tapping into students’ existing mental frameworks, we can cultivate a more engaged and participative classroom environment.
